Tata Motors is set to redefine the electric vehicle landscape with the upcoming Tata Harrier EV, which promises a groundbreaking range of 500 kilometers on a single charge. The recent release of new pictures on the company’s website has generated immense excitement, providing a sneak peek into the SUV’s instrument console and its potential to revolutionize electric SUVs in India.
Instrument Console Reveals Charging Control and Range:
The images showcase the instrument console of the Tata Harrier EV, highlighting the charging control and an initial range of 400 kilometers with an 80% battery charge. This insight suggests a potential extension of 100 kilometers with the remaining 20% charge, setting a new benchmark for Tata’s electric SUV lineup.
Expected Features of the Harrier EV:
Beyond its impressive range, the Harrier EV is anticipated to boast a range of advanced features, including a 10.25-inch infotainment screen, fully digital color instrument cluster, panoramic sunroof, drive modes, ventilated front seats, a new gear dial, and an electric parking brake with an auto-hold function. While details about the battery remain undisclosed, the SUV is gearing up to deliver a state-of-the-art driving experience.
